Requirements
- Greeting patients/family, scheduling patient appointments, scheduling hospital and ambulatory admissions/procedures
- Answering the telephone promptly and dealing with callers needs
- Maintaining communication resources, i.e. on-call schedule, MD phone numbers and beeper numbers
- Preparing charts for new patients
- Reconciling encounters daily
- Monitors supply inventory, completes and directs requisitions for supplies, forms, equipment or services
- Performing various clerical duties including faxing, photocopying, filing and mailings
- Obtains, verifies and updates patient information
- Accurately completes any/all necessary forms for the patients
- Respects patient’s rights
- Establishes and maintains a positive working relationship with physicians and nursing staff
- Protects the privacy and confidentiality of patients and employees
- Communicates any problems, equipment concerns or issues promptly to the Nurse Manager
